It’s easy to measure the space between the rear dropouts. It should be 135 if i remember correctly. If its much less than that the rear wheel will be difficult to insert and i would contact the dealer
By fork you mean the rear dropout?those nubs should nestle right into the dropouts without resistance.
Sometimes the chain under tension can make this awkward and cockeyed, try having a second person relieve tension of the derailleur while installing.
